Abstract
An ice blasting machine comprising a crusher for crushing water ice; and a crusher-activation mechanism to activate or deactivate the crusher, wherein the crusher is activated to operate in water ice mode and wherein the crusher is deactivated to operate in dry ice mode. An ice-blasting method including activating a crusher to crush water ice when operating in water ice mode and deactivating the crusher when operating in dry ice mode.
Claims
1. An ice blasting machine comprising: a hatch through which water ice or dry ice is loaded into the ice blasting machine; a crusher for crushing the water ice; a crusher-activation mechanism to activate or deactivate the crusher to crush the water ice when operating in water ice mode, wherein the crusher is activated to operate in the water ice mode and wherein the crusher is deactivated to operate in dry ice mode such that the dry ice is not crushed by the crusher; an outlet hose for outputting the water ice or the dry ice that has been entrained into a high-speed stream of pressurized air from an air pump or compressed air tank; and a switch to switch between the water ice mode and the dry ice mode, wherein the switch causes the crusher-activation mechanism to activate or deactivate the crusher.
2. The ice blasting machine of claim 1 wherein the crusher is a V-shaped crusher having two jaws.
3. The ice blasting machine of claim 2 wherein the crusher-activation mechanism comprises a reversing cam clutch disengagement system.
4. The ice blasting machine of claim 2 wherein the crusher-activation mechanism comprises a worm gear style crusher teeth retraction mechanism.
5. The ice blasting machine of claim 2 wherein the crusher-activation mechanism comprises a lead screw style crusher tooth retraction mechanism.
6. The ice blasting machine of claim 1 further comprising a portable frame having wheels.
7. An ice-blasting method comprising: providing an ice blasting machine according to claim 1; activating the crusher to crush the water ice when operating in the water ice mode; and deactivating the crusher when operating in the dry ice mode.

[0031] In at least some embodiments, the crusher is activated when operating in water ice mode to enable the ice blasting machine to crush large chunks of ice into smaller bits of ice whereas the crusher is deactivated when operating in dry ice mode.
[0032] For the purposes of this specification, the expression “water ice mode” means that the machine is blasting only water ice particles.
[0033] For the purposes of this specification, the expression “dry ice mode” means that the machine is blasting only dry ice particles.
[0034] It will be appreciated that the ice blasting machine may have a switch, controller, programmable logic controller or processor to switch, either manually or automatically, between water ice and dry ice modes. The switch may be disposed on the handheld nozzle or alternatively on the frame.
